UVA: UVA is ultraviolet radiation with wavelengths from 320-400 nanometers. It passes through the Earth’s ozone layer and can cause early aging of the skin.
UVB: UVB is ultraviolet radiation with wavelengths of 280-320 nanometers. The ozone layer absorbs most of the sun’s UVB, but even a small amount can do substantial damage. UVB causes skin cancer and may contribute to cataracts.
